MSc in Mathematics: Eligibility Criteria

The minimum eligibility criteria for the MSc Mathematics course are

  • Passed BSc (Mathematics) or BSc (Mathematics with Computer Science Applications) or any other relevant degree with Mathematics and English as main subject.
  • Secured minimum of 60% marks in aggregate (Varies from University to University).
  • Some institutes also consider BE/BTech qualified candidates.
  • Few universities allow admission in the postgraduate course on the merit basis and some institutes through the merit basis.
